About this movie

ACT OF VALOUR stars active-duty Navy Seals who take you deep into the secretive world of the most elite, highly trained and deadly group of warriors in modern combat. When the rescue of a kidnapped CIA operative leads to the discovery of a deadly terrorist plot, a team of SEALs is dispatched on a global manhunt. As the men race to stop a coordinated attack that could kill and wound thousands of innocent civilians, they must balance their commitments to country, team, and their families back home. Based on real events, the film combines stunning combat sequences, up-to-the minute battlefield technology and heart-pumping emotion for the ultimate action adventure. - © 2011 RELATIVITY MEDIA.
